The next thing I did isnt shown. I measured and cut off my electrical PVC, then drilled a 7/8 inch hole with a wood spade bit in my ceiling. Then I crawled up there and poked the end of my 10/2 romex wire down through the hole. I had the Powder Puff grab the end and pull it to the ground. Better to have too much wire than not enough, right?

Then I threaded the wire through the PVC pipe.

Now for the plug. Heres a little tip. Don't strip your wires sheathing with a razor by pulling it all the way up or down the wire. You might nick the other wires inside!

To view some links or images in this forum your post count must be 1 or greater. You currently have 0 posts. Maybe you should introduce yourself with a new topic?

Instead just use your dykes and snip the sheathing about 1/2 inch deep from the end like this.



To view some links or images in this forum your post count must be 1 or greater. You currently have 0 posts. Maybe you should introduce yourself with a new topic?







Then just peel it back with your fingers or with a pair of pliers. It peels back easy once you get a slit cut in the front.



To view some links or images in this forum your post count must be 1 or greater. You currently have 0 posts. Maybe you should introduce yourself with a new topic?







Now put connect your receptacle. Black is "x" or gold screw, white is "y" or silver screw, green is the bare or green wire.
